The injury nightmare for Roma continues. The Giallorossi announced that Nikola Kalinić suffered a fracture to his fibula bone while midfielder Bryan Cristante suffered an injury to the adductor tendon in his right thigh and that both will begin their course of rehabilitation.
Neither is expected to undergo surgery, however, Il Tempo reports the Croatian will miss roughly two months of action while Cristante, according to TeleRadioStereo, will miss upwards of three months. A huge blow for Roma who are already hampered by several injuries.
